Safety

It is essential to select a safe wood stove when you purchase one. Find a model that has been approved by Underwriters Laboratories (UL) or any other recognized testing laboratory. Also, ensure that the hinges, legs, and grates are secure and in good condition. Keep in mind that stoves can create high temperatures. They are not recommended to be used in close proximity to flammable materials like curtains or draperies.

It is important to buy the stove that comes with an air intake system capable of reducing the buildup flammable creosote deposits in the chimney. This will increase the efficiency of your stove as well as reduce fuel consumption. Make sure to use only wood that is seasoned to avoid fire hazards and ensure proper burning.

Installing a blower could be required if you own an older house or a building envelope that is more rigid. This will help spread the heat evenly throughout your home. This can also help reduce drafts of cold air that can be found around windows and doors caused by the stove removing warm air out of the room.

It is also important to be aware of any regulations which require your stove to be placed in a certain distance from non-combustible surfaces. The manual for your stove will include this information, so be sure to follow it.
